Join Parkland Medical Center as a Registered Nurse in the PACU, where you will provide critical care and support to patients post-anesthesia. This role involves assessing patient conditions, performing medical procedures, and ensuring thorough documentation while collaborating with a dedicated healthcare team.
Key Responsibilities
Assess patient condition during admission and each shift, identifying and reporting any changes in patient status
Perform procedures or other functions as ordered by the medical provider
Document the administration of care in the patient medical record in a timely and thorough manner
Perform the administration of prescribed medications and monitor response
Maintain knowledge of medications, procedures, and equipment used in the care of cardiac and medical-surgical patients
Required Qualifications
Active New Hampshire nursing license or compact Registered Nurse license
Graduate of Accredited School of Nursing, BSN preferred
Minimum two years of critical care nursing experience
American Heart Association BCLS
American Heart Association ACLS within 30 days of hire
American Heart Association PALS or ENPC within 30 days of hire
CPI within 30 days of hire
Preferred Qualifications
TNCC preferred
